Here’s the thing. Your direct response advertising is really all about reading.
Reading envelope teasers.
Reading letters.
Reading brochures.
Reading order forms.
Reading headlines.
Reading coupons.
Reading e-mail.
Reading web content.
Reading all manner of things.
Without reading — easy, effortless reading — you have no sales. This is why they say, “Copy” and by extension “Content” is king.
Therefore, design should always strive to :
- Draw attention to the copy and help the reader get started reading;
- Make reading easy by applying the basic rules of layout and typography; and
- Help communicate the writer’s message and not produce a work of art.
